Aprobrium LTD T/A Lexacom

Banbury
SME

Lexacom specializes in workflow management, speech recognition, and ambient AI solutions for healthcare, legal, and professional sectors. They offer tools to streamline documentation and improve patient communication.

Quick answer — Aprobrium LTD T/A LexacomUpdated 13 Jul 2026

At a glance · for buyers and watchdogs

Aprobrium LTD T/A Lexacom has won £8.0m across 3 public-sector buyers, with 3 live contracts. No active Companies House risk flags.

Why: top buyer NHS SHARED BUSINESS SERVICES LIMITED at 97% · 0 active risk flags · 0 modifications.
